A man with the right look, the right skills, and a past that shadowed every mile. On the frontier, a man needs little-a good horse, a steady hand, and the grit to face what trails behind him. Sam Remington carried all three into Eaton, along with war scars that never quite healed. He wasn't seeking glory, just honest work. Work came easy-and turned deadly fast. A message run on a fast black gelding ended in ambush, gunsmoke, and dead men cooling in the dirt. Longhorn cattle drives crushed men into the earth. In a land still bleeding from the Civil War, this country didn't hand out second chances. Still, Eaton offered more than scars and gun smoke. A chance at true love gave him reason to plant roots, even as rustlers prowled the hills, bushwhackers waited in the gullies, and a dangerous man rode with greed, revenge and violence in his wake. Sam wasn't anyone's tool and the town of Eaton wasn't the end of the trail. It was the beginning of a reckoning that could write him into legend-or into the ground.
